/// <summary>
/// datagridview转datatable
/// </summary>
/// <param name="dv"></param>
/// <returns></returns>
public DataTable dvtodt(DataGridView dv)
{
DataTable dt = new DataTable();
DataColumn dc;
for (int i = 0; i < dv.Columns.Count; i++)
{
dc = new DataColumn();
dc.ColumnName = dv.Columns[i].HeaderText.ToString();
dt.Columns.Add(dc);
}
for (int j = 0; j < dv.Rows.Count - 1; j++)
{
DataRow dr = dt.NewRow();
for (int x = 0; x < dv.Columns.Count; x++)
{
dr[x] = dv.Rows[j].Cells[x].Value;
}
dt.Rows.Add(dr);
}
return dt;
}
datagridview转datatable
最新推荐文章于 2025-10-29 10:53:21 发布
本文介绍了一种将DataGridView控件中的数据转换为DataTable的方法。通过创建一个新的DataTable实例并添加列,然后遍历DataGridView的行来填充数据。
4万+

被折叠的 条评论
为什么被折叠?



